The last two dates of the South American Qualifiers will be played simultaneouslyproduct of the narrow definition to qualify for the Qatar 2022 World Cup. The Chilean team will face Brazil as a visitor on March 24 and Uruguay at home on March 29.
Through a letter sent by FIFA and published by the Peruvian team, through its Twitter account, it was reported that the vast majority of the commitments (including those of La Roja) will take place on both days mentioned at 8:30 p.m. (11:30 p.m. GMT).
The only exceptions will be the commitments to be played by Argentina against Venezuela and Bolivia against Brazil, since they are teams that are classified to Qatar or eliminated.
The Red needs to add, at least, three points and depends on other results to get into the playoffs or directly into the planetary event. Four points improves the scenario of those led by Martín Lasarte and six leaves it almost assured in one of the two objectives.
In addition, the Chilean Federation is evaluating San Carlos de Apoquindo, Calama and Concepción as venues for the decisive duel against Uruguay, according to the Al Aire Libre journalist, Sebastián Esnaola.
